From Carmen and Ingo...WOW! Seriously! This has been an incredible day for us. Not only the fantastic venue or the perfect weather between all this rain. But most of all because Anastasia and Marc are such humbled and super nice people. We connected very well already during our meeting last year in Vienna, but during their wedding day the four of us got good friends! Anastasia is such a beautiful bride and Carmen’s eyes were glowing when she left the getting ready in Schloss Dürnstein. She was even hugging Anastasia now and then during the day, just because she was such a lovely bride.
Marc is a real gentleman not only to his wonderful wife but to everyone he is talking to. It was a super pleasure to be around him and listen to what he has to say. Speaking five (or even more) languages makes him also standout in conversations with the international guests. Making jokes is one of his favorite things but doing that in Russian language with his father in law qualifies him for a good husband. Getting ready and the reception was held in Schloss Dürnstein. Never been there before but totally felt in love with the venue and the surrounding. Those rooms are just gorgeous. The civil ceremony was held in the library of the Castle Dürnstein only with the closest friends and family. Before the church of Stift Dürnstein was place for the religious wedding ceremony the bride and groom changed from super beautiful dress and suite to absolutely stunning clothing. What a wonderful dress right?
The ceremony hold some specialties for all the guests, since there were so many different languages everything was translated from German into English language and also most parts into Russian. Anastasia and Marc gave us plenty of time to do the portrait shoot and we had so much fun with them capturing their unconditional love for each other. The reception in Schloss Dürnstein (Rosensaal) started with singing and saxophone from Jengis. What a nice guy! We had the pleasure to talk with him and also with his buddy who was responsible for the DJ work after him. Mr. Steve Nick. If you are looking for some really fun people to entertain your guests, these guys blow our minds with their performance. All hats off guy, your rock!
Marc is from Syria originally and parts of his family are suffering under the political conflict right now and where not able to escape the country over the last years. Even A&M were spending their wonderful day they did not forget to thing about everyone effected by the sad situation. Marc found really great words in his speak and shows one more time his well-considered thinking! It’s been such a wonderful day for us and here is to thank you both so much for putting trust into our work and us. We are very looking forward meeting you someday soon again and it’s a true pleasure seeing your LOVE sparkling between you. Have a fantastic future!
